How to Make Popcorn Balls

Popcorn balls are a great treat for kids on Halloween or for decorating during the holiday season. Whether they are for eating or for display, anyone can learn how to make popcorn balls.
First: The supplies
Get your ingredients together. You need 1 cup of both granulated and brown sugar, 1/2 cup of corn syrup, 2/3 cup of water, 1 tablespoon of butter or margarine, 3 1/2 quarts of popcorn (popped) and 1 teaspoon of salt. Combine the sugars, corn syrup and water in a saucepan, stirring constantly until all of the sugar breaks up and liquefies.
Second: The mixture
Add the butter and cook without stirring until the mixture gets to 240 degrees. Pour the cooked popcorn (removing any unpopped kernels) into a big mixing bowl and add the salt. Take the hot sugar syrup and slowly pour it onto the popcorn. Stir it up thoroughly.
Third: The formation
Butter your hands; grab a handful of the mixture and shape it into a ball. Place each finished popcorn ball on a buttered cookie sheet. Repeat this process until the popcorn mixture is gone.
Fourth: The decoration
After the popcorn balls have cooled, wrap them in cellophane wrap or waxed paper. To attach candies or other small treats to the popcorn balls, melt 2/3 cup of small marshmallows with 2 teaspoons of shortening over low heat. While the mixture is warm, dip the candies into the marshmallow glue and stick them on to decorate the balls.
